Islamabad: A Pakistani anti-terror court conducting the trial of LeT`s Zakiur Rehman Lakhvi and six others charged with involvement in the 2008 Mumbai attacks has adjourned the proceedings till August 10 after a key defence lawyer informed the judge that he was unwell.

Khwaja Sultan, the counsel for Lakhvi, informed judge Shahid Rafique at the Rawalpindi-based court yesterday that he was unwell and sought an adjournment of the hearing.
